SAPROPEL

SAPROPEL, mineral and organic sediments of swamps, lakes, ponds, etc, formed as a result of physical and biochemical processes. S. colloids, impregnated with mineralized water or brines, consist of alumina and iron oxide hydrates, iron sulphide and clay particles. S. are used in balneotherapy, in agriculture as a fertilizer. In the Bashkir Pre‑Urals, the total of approx. 50 million m3 S. is deposited in the bayou lakes of the basins of the Belaya and Dyoma rivers, in Asylykul and Kandrykul lakes, near mineral springs, etc. S. of the Syrian‑Tuba Lake (Gafuriysky Raion) are represented by black, dark gray and gray sludge with moisture content of 42.6—49.7%, average volume weight of 1.34 g/cm3, contamination with vegetation residue, sand 3%, content of organic substances 3.8—4.0%, sulphides 0.13—0.16%, mineralization 3.7 g/l; sulfate sodium‑calcium. The largest S. deposits in the Bashkir Trans‑Urals are associated with lakes Talkas, Uzunkul, Urgun, Chebarkul, etc with the total volume of more than 120 million m3. S. of the Muldakkul Lake is represented by black sludge with humidity up to 83%, volume weight of 1.25 g/cm3; sulfate chloride‑sodium. S. is used at Assy, Karagay, Krasnousolsk, Yakty­Kul, Yangan­Tau and other health resorts.
